本文目录导读:
随着互联网技术的飞速发展,越来越多的企业选择通过建立自己的官方网站来展示企业形象、宣传产品和服务,ASP(Active Server Pages)作为微软公司推出的一种服务器端脚本环境,因其易用性和强大的功能而受到众多企业的青睐,本文将深入解析公司网站ASP源码,从架构设计到优化策略,为广大开发者提供有益的参考。
图片来源于网络,如有侵权联系删除
公司网站ASP源码架构解析
1、技术选型
公司网站ASP源码采用以下技术架构:
(1)服务器端:Windows Server操作系统,IIS(Internet Information Services)作为Web服务器,ASP.NET作为服务器端脚本环境。
(2)数据库:Microsoft SQL Server,用于存储网站数据。
(3)前端:HTML、CSS、JavaScript等,用于实现页面布局和交互。
2、架构设计
(1)模块化设计:将网站功能划分为多个模块,如首页、产品展示、新闻动态、客户案例等,便于开发和维护。
(2)分层设计:将系统分为表现层、业务逻辑层和数据访问层,实现职责分离,提高代码复用性和可维护性。
(3)缓存机制:采用内存缓存和数据库缓存,提高网站访问速度。
公司网站ASP源码优化策略
1、数据库优化
图片来源于网络,如有侵权联系删除
(1)索引优化:合理创建索引,提高数据查询效率。
(2)存储过程优化:将常用查询操作封装为存储过程,减少数据库访问次数。
(3)数据分页:对大数据量进行分页查询,提高页面加载速度。
2、代码优化
(1)代码规范:遵循编码规范,提高代码可读性和可维护性。
(2)性能优化:采用异步编程、事件驱动等技术,提高代码执行效率。
(3)减少HTTP请求:合并CSS、JavaScript文件,减少HTTP请求次数。
3、前端优化
(1)图片优化:压缩图片,减少图片大小,提高页面加载速度。
(2)CSS优化:使用CSS精灵技术,减少HTTP请求次数。
图片来源于网络,如有侵权联系删除
(3)JavaScript优化:使用压缩、合并、懒加载等技术,提高页面加载速度。
4、服务器优化
(1)负载均衡:采用负载均衡技术,提高服务器并发处理能力。
(2)缓存策略:设置合理的缓存策略,提高网站访问速度。
(3)安全优化:定期更新系统补丁,防止安全漏洞。
公司网站ASP源码架构设计合理,功能完善,通过以上优化策略,可以有效提高网站性能和用户体验,在开发过程中,开发者应注重代码质量、优化数据库和服务器配置,以提高网站整体性能,关注前端优化,提升用户体验,使网站更具竞争力。
深入解析公司网站ASP源码,对架构和优化策略进行分析,有助于提高网站性能和用户体验,希望本文能为广大开发者提供有益的参考。
标签: #公司网站asp源码
评论列表